Title of article :
Experimental absolute intensities of the 4ν9 and 5ν9 O–H stretching overtones of H2SO4

Abstract :
This work uses cavity ring-down spectroscopy to measure two high vibrational overtones (4ν9 and 5ν9) of the O–H stretch in sulfuric acid. The frequencies, bandwidths, and intensities are obtained for these previously unobserved transitions. The atmospheric J-values for the overtone-induced photodissociation are calculated using the experimental cross-sections. Accurate J-values are essential for understanding the formation of the springtime polar sulfate layer by overtone-induced dehydration of H2SO4. The results are compared to previous experimental and theoretical studies of sulfuric acid.
